Lots of good cardio drills with the kettle bells, they've just become established a normal piece of gym equipment, so you don't hear about them as much as when they were a popular fad.

Girevoy Sport is still pretty huge in the eastern countries, and has a decent following in the States, although they may not call it that. Many of the known Girevoy guys have crazy endurance levels -
